8th March 2023: International Women's Day event with Dublin Chamber

LEO logo                                                          Dublin Chamber logo

“International Women’s Day 2023: An opportunity for inspiration and networking!"

Wednesday 8th March 17.30-21.00

Radisson Blu Royal Hotel, Golden Lane, Dublin 8 D08 VRR7

The Local Enterprise Offices in Dublin and the Dublin Chamber will hold a major International Women's Day 2022 celebration on 8th March, which will bring over 250 of Ireland’s most successful business leaders and female entrepreneurs together for an evening of networking and learning. Natasha Adams, CEO Republic of Ireland for Tesco PLC

Natasha TESCO
Natasha was appointed as CEO Republic of Ireland in April 2022 having been the Chief People Officer
since June 2018, in both roles as part of Tesco Group Executive Committee.
As Chief People Officer, Natasha was a Trustee for the Tesco Pension Scheme, sat on the Tesco Cyber
Security Committee and Tesco Privacy and Data Committee, advisor to both the Tesco Board and the
Remuneration and Nominations & Governance Committees on remuneration, succession planning and
recruitment while also being a Steering Group Member for both Movement to Work and the 30% Club.
Natasha is a Companion of the Chartered Institute of Personnel and Development, a trustee for IGD and a
Non-Executive Director for Berkeley Holding Group Limited.
A Tesco colleague since 1998, Natasha has held a number of leadership roles in Retail Operations and
People functions, always enjoying the pace colleagues, customers and suppliers bring to the retail environment.

Julie McLoughlin, Co-Founder, JANDO

Julie low res
Julie is Co-Founder of JANDO, the multi-award winning printmakers based in The Chocolate Factory, Dublin 1. Specialising in colourful, landmark and architectural themed prints, JANDO skilfully blends a combination of both traditional and modern printmaking techniques, including screen printing and hand drawn illustration to create their distinctive body of work. Working with some of the biggest retailers, museums and heritage sites here in Ireland and abroad, Julie is the main screen printer at JANDO and also oversees everything from operations, to brand strategy to customer service.
Julie is obsessed with the movies of Wes Anderson and she believes in a healthy balance of work, design and life, with a cocktail or two thrown in for good measure.

Katharine Deas, Oriana B

Katharine 1

Katharine Deas founded Oriana B (www.orianab.com), a furniture and homewares ‘Emporium of Amazingness’ according to The Irish Times, in 2019.  She is a seasoned business leader with many years of corporate management experience which she couples with a deep love of great furniture and European decorative arts.  Since inception, Oriana B has delivered over 10,000 orders, has a 5* TrustPilot profile, 17.6k Instagram followers and a developed a range of over 900 beautiful pieces of furniture and homewares. Based in Dublin, Katharine leads a talented team of creatives in her mission to deliver the most intriguing interiors in Ireland.

Charmaine Kenny, Co-Founder, Hatched Analytics

Charmaine Kenny IWD 2023
Charmaine has over ten years’ experience in management consulting (The Parthenon Group, London) and operational management positions (Paddy Power, Dublin/London). Her business experience is characterised by using data to make decisions. This experience coupled with her MBA from Stanford’s Graduate School of Business, enables Charmaine to productise data efficiently and effectively. Charmaine also co-founded The Irish Workshop, an online marketplace – a digital experience that lends itself to Hatched.  Hatched Analytics' reports help institutional investors make better decisions, offering the most accurate data on the headline performance of companies worldwide.  They currently offer coverage of 50 global tickers, with reports predicting over 76 reported KPIs.
